In De Ruyter, standard dog boarding typically costs between $25 and $45 per night. This price often includes basic care, feeding, and daily exercise in a secure, outdoor run. Rates may be higher for larger suites, multiple dogs from the same family, or during peak holiday seasons.

You should pack your pet's regular food to prevent stomach upset, any required medications with clear instructions, and their current vaccination records. Due to the potential for cooler evenings in the De Ruyter area, you might also consider bringing an extra blanket or a familiar piece of your clothing to provide comfort and warmth.
Reputable facilities in De Ruyter have detailed emergency plans that include protocols for power outages or severe Upstate New York weather. They will have a working relationship with a local veterinarian and secure, climate-controlled indoor areas to ensure all animals are safe and comfortable, no matter the conditions outside.
Yes, all reputable De Ruyter kennels require proof of current vaccinations, typically including Rabies, DHLPP, and Bordetella (kennel cough). It's crucial to confirm these requirements with your chosen facility well ahead of your booking, as some may also recommend flea and tick prevention due to the wooded, rural landscape.
